bienvenidos

welcome


Adjective bienvenidos m pl

  1. masculine plural of bienvenido

Examples
  • Los visitantes son bienvenidos.

    Visitors are welcome.

  • Bienvenidos a los Estados Unidos.

    Welcome to the United States.

  • Bienvenidos a Wikipedia.

    Welcome to Wikipedia.

  • Bienvenidos, prisioneros... Quiero decir, invitados.

    Welcome, prisoners... I mean, guests.

  • Pensé que éramos bienvenidos aquí.

    I thought we were welcome here.

  • ¡Bienvenidos a nuestra casa!

    Welcome to our home!

  • Los extranjeros a menudo no se sienten bienvenidos aquí.

    Foreigners often feel unwelcome here.

  • Bienvenidos a Boston.

    Welcome to Boston.

  • Señoras y señores, sean bienvenidos.

    Ladies and gentlemen, please be welcomed.

  • Bienvenidos a nuestra primera clase de alemán.

    Welcome to our 1st German class.
